#4af888 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4af888 is composed of 29% red, 97.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 141.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 63.1%. #4af888 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00f111.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#4af888 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4af888 has RGB values of R:74, G:248,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 4913288.

Shades and Tints of #4af888
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000803 is the darkest color, while #f4f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4af888
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a1a1 is the less saturated color, while #4af888 is the most saturated one.
